Summary

Ankeny Code of Ordinances § 111.04 guarantees residential solid waste pickup at least once every week, with commercial, industrial and institutional premises collected as often as necessary but never less than weekly, under service contracted by the City through licensed private haulers.

111.04 FREQUENCY OF COLLECTION. All solid waste shall be collected from residential premises at least once each week and from commercial, industrial and institutional premises as frequently as may be necessary, but not less than once each week.

Full Breakdown

Section 111.04 sets the baseline collection frequency for the City's contracted solid waste system: residential premises must be collected at least once each week, and commercial, industrial and institutional premises must be collected as frequently as necessary for their volume, but in no case less than once each week. Section 111.01 establishes that this collection is performed under private contract with collectors licensed by the City rather than by a City crew, and § 111.07 requires every hauler to hold an annual collector's license from the Clerk, backed by public liability insurance of at least $100,000 per person and $300,000 per occurrence for bodily injury and $50,000 for property damage, plus a $200.00 annual license fee.

Section 111.02 requires the vehicles and containers used for collection to be leakproof, durable, easily cleanable and maintained in good repair, and § 111.03 requires loads to be covered and secured so nothing falls, leaks or spills, with any spillage picked up immediately and the area cleaned. Section 111.06 lets a licensed collector enter private property to collect solid waste as the chapter requires, but bars collectors from entering dwelling units or other residential buildings. Together these sections guarantee Ankeny residents a minimum weekly pickup performed by a City-licensed, insured contractor operating compliant equipment.

Violations & Fines

A licensed collector who fails to meet the weekly minimum in § 111.04, or who operates without the § 111.07 collector's license, is enforceable as a municipal infraction under § 4.01, carrying the standard civil penalty in § 4.03: not to exceed $750.00 for a first offense and not to exceed $1,000.00 for each repeat offense.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often does Ankeny require trash pickup?
Section 111.04 requires residential solid waste to be collected at least once every week. Commercial, industrial and institutional premises must be collected as frequently as necessary for their volume, but never less than once each week either, so no property in the City can go longer than seven days between pickups.
Who picks up the trash in Ankeny?
Section 111.01 assigns solid waste collection to private contractors licensed by the City rather than a municipal crew. Section 111.07 requires each hauler to hold an annual $200.00 collector's license and carry public liability insurance of at least $100,000 per person and $300,000 per occurrence.
Can the trash collector come inside my house in Ankeny?
No. Section 111.06 authorizes licensed collectors to enter private property to collect solid waste as required by Chapter 111, but it expressly bars collectors from entering dwelling units or other residential buildings, limiting their access to the yard, curb or approved container location.
